I'm about two days new to this site and currently taking in lots of valuable information. I have not been able to use MQ yet as I'm still somewhat of a newb. Ok, ok...enough boring chatter. Here is my question.

I play a 70 druid and a buddy of mine plays a 70 warrior. His play time is limited so I box him frequently in the Plane of Fire to leach exp. I will use him to tank casters but other than that, he's useless. What I'm wondering is this. Is there a macro that will allow him to autofollow the mob I'm kiting and hit it? It would make things so much more convenient and kills would be faster.

On a side note, what are the odds of being caught? My druid is my original character and I have 800 AA's. My friends warrior is also his main character and he has about 860 AA's. I know there is some risk of being caught. I would just hate to be banned after all the time invested. Any info and opinions are greatly appreciated. Thanks,

I think it's pretty much accepted as a general rule that that you shouldn't gamble with something you can't afford to lose. Your odds of being caught are pretty much up to you. If you use MQ2 wisely, you will probably not be caught. If you go warping around and talking about MQ2 in game and so on, or doing AFK macros out in public areas, your odds of getting caught will go way up.

If you are afraid of getting caught, I wouldn't use MQ2 on those accounts that you value.

That's pretty much the only advice I can offer on this subject.
 
DirtyDruid said:
What I'm wondering is this. Is there a macro that will allow him to autofollow the mob I'm kiting and hit it?

There are several Melee macros in the general macro section on the Macroquest2 website or you can also use the Autobot/Raiddruid script in the VIP Macro section to accomplish this.

Having your warrior autofollow around a kited mob attacking it is very low risk as long as you are there at the keyboard and not using warp. If you use one of the macro's from the MQ2 site and are physically there kiting, I don't see any problems. The Autobot/Raiddruid script is nice to because you can configure it to automatically ask for buffs on your warrior.
